Output 69c594103dd5801235a87f803481c45e6b403c3a29cb9b08166dea48858162ff:2

value
520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e44bc7db477cad44cb448ca664ef4c42c7f882 OP_EQUALVERIFY OP_CHECKSIG
address
17HGSL8obg34PHWLULfrfKrSPv4WxqSbK3
transaction
69c594103dd5801235a87f803481c45e6b403c3a29cb9b08166dea48858162ff
spent
true